Address

oTNWe4eSWvS1iT4Zc9NqQ9Eq4SfEDC1JiP

0 TFLO

Confirmed
Total Received8.22714600 TFLO
Total Sent8.22714600 TFLO
Final Balance0 TFLO
No. Transactions2

Transactions

FLO Data
FLO Data